    Netherstorm - Spam kill/loot mobs


    There is currently an area in Netherstorm (see video for location) called Chapel Yard that houses Tormented Citizens and Tormented Souls. These mobs have up to 7,850 health and change forms once you enter combat with them.

    You need to be able to one shot them or provide enough shatter damage to get them down almost instant; basically kill them before they can change forms. You need to start out of combat of course so they don't change forms too soon.

    If you have done it right, they will die but come back with barely any health. As soon as they come back you can kill them with an instant spell or auto attack once more and loot again, repeat.

    There is not currently any loot table for these mobs like it says on Wowhead.com other then the quest item. This means they took it out on purpose because they knew about this or it is a mistake for the current build. In any case it allowed me to get almost all my quest items off of one mob and these may yield XP. I have no way to test that but if it does, you could spam this for XP. You can also apply this to any other mobs in the game that change forms upon combat.
